General Description

The designer will produce construction drawings and details for treatment plants, water distribution systems, and sewer collection systems. The designer will contribute to other related projects, and work side by side with civil engineers, surveyors, project managers, CADD designers, and project administrators.

Essential Duties

· Produce civil/mechanical plans for water and wastewater facilities.

· Prepare accurate construction plans and details with input from the Project Engineer and Project Manager.

· Interpret sketches and markups provided by the Project Engineer and other team members.

· Collaborate with the design engineer, project manager, and project administrators in the planning and production of a complete set of construction documents.

· Utilize company CAD standards effectively in addition to updating templates and any other CADD processes for the team’s needs.

· Perform administrative and other duties as assigned.

Required Education and Experience

· Associate’s degree in CAD or Design/Drafting Technology, preferred.

· Must have at least 3-5 years of experience.

· Experience in the preparation of construction plans for water and wastewater facilities, preferred.

· Experience in civil and mechanical design preferred.
